The Many Shades of Gray

by Donna Fitzgerald  |  June 18, 2009  |  Comments Off

 It occurred to me this morning that we might need to be clearer about what the difference is between an apprentice, a journeyman and a master PM.   

An apprentice works with black and white.  He believes all knowledge comes from an authority and must be followed exactly.

A journeyman works with shades of gray.  She finds that there are at least three different perspectives on every ‘rule” she ever learned and knows if she lives long enough she’ll probably find a circumstance where each one of those variations will be true.

A master works with black alone because black is the sum of all colors.  He is comfortable with oppositions, contrasts and subtleties and takes them all in stride, celebrating their richness.

 

You can generally recognize a Master when you meet him or her.  It’s the apprentice with 15 years experience that tends to be the source of the problem.
